Tukaram Mundhe advises against purchasing loose edible oil
Maharashtra FDA Commissioner Tukaram Mundhe has appealed to the public to avoid buying loose edible oil, noting that it is hard to identify the producer if food poisoning occurs. He further explained that poor packaging, improper handling, and the repeated use of such oil can lead to heart issues, cancer, and hinder the mental growth of children. The FDA is now preparing to implement more rigorous monitoring of the edible oil supply chain.
